Apr 26, 20 xampp configuration to secure mysql, phpmyadmin and localhost posted on april 26, 20 by rferdian45 this is a note how to configure xampp after installing xampp in your computer. This file will download from phpmyadmins developer website. Released 20200321, see release notes for details current version compatible with php 7. You can also directly download latest version on following urls. All managed hosting accounts already include phpmyadmin in cpanel. If you have a new installed kali linux system read our tutorial on top ten must do things after installing kali linux. Howto install, configure, and secure phpmyadmin on windows. The phpmyadmin package thats available from freebsd repository, not compatible with php version 7. Dec 11, 2017 this secure connection will allow you to connect to your servers phpmyadmin page in order to safely make changes to your websites database. Many operating systems already include a phpmyadmin package and will automatically keep it updated, however these versions are sometimes slightly outdated and therefore may be missing the latest features. The installation mainly consists of extracting the distribution and editing the database authentication information. Mar 04, 2020 for this tutorial ill be teaching you how you can create your very own secure php login system, a login form is what your websites visitors will use to login to your website to access content for loggedin users such as a profile page. Next, get the latest download link from the phpmyadmin download page and download.
Frequently used operations managing databases, tables, columns, relations, indexes, users, permissions, etc can be performed via the user interface, while you still have the ability. For beginners, or those that are lazy, there is the phpmyadmin tool to help us with the maintenance and interface of mysql. However, if you want to use a version of phpmyadmin newer. Now, you have to configure apache web server in order to use phpmyadmin. Dec 26, 2017 phpmyadmin supports a wide range of operations with mysql.
Follow our security announcements and upgrade phpmyadmin whenever new vulnerability is published. Nevertheless the link i provided gives more insight to the process of configuring phpmyadmin catalesia. Mar, 2020 in this raspberry pi phpmyadmin tutorial, we will take you through the steps on how to install the popular mysql administration tool phpmyadmin to your raspberry pi. Many other projects, including wordpress, are backed by a mysql database and rely on its extensive feature list and simple setup. To setup nginx to work with phpmyadmin, we need to do is create a link between the phpmyadmin folder and our root html directory. For anyone who doesnt know, phpmyadmin is a free tool that has been designed to allow for easy administration of mysql. Additionally, the configuration process varies widely by package and may not adhere to the official phpmyadmin documentation. For those who dont know, phpmyadmin is a free software tool written in php, intended to handle the administration of mysql over the web. The key can be either obtained from the keyserver or is available in phpmyadmin keyring available on our download server or using keybase.
The location depends on your setup identify the folder from. How to install phpmyadmin on your windows pc wikihow. But still web application like phpmyadmin can be vulnerable to a number of attacks and new ways to exploit are still being explored. How to install phpmyadmin in kali linux and debian. A free software tool written in php, intended to handle the administration of mysql over the web. We can easily secure our phpmyadmin installation by using. It provides a convenient visual front end to the mysql capabilities. Jan 28, 2019 naturally, because phpmyadmin is such a common application installed on many web servers, it is a popular target for unauthorized access attempts. Frequently used operations managing databases, tables, columns, relations, indexes, users, permissions, etc can be performed via the user interface, while you still have the ability to directly execute any. Sep 03, 2016 in this tip, we will show you how to change and secure the default phpmyadmin login url to stop attackers from targeting your linux server. How to install phpmyadmin on iis in windows server. In this article we will secure phpmyadmin using a change of the directory name and a.
To access it from a remote system, you must create an ssh tunnel that routes requests to the web server from 127. Wampdeveloper pro with phpmyadmin easytouse web server software using apache, php, mysql and phpmyadmin for windows. In this article, i will show you how to install and secure phpmyadmin on the oneclick wordpress app. This article describes how to install phpmyadmin on a managed hosting account. The most frequently used operations are supported by the user interface managing databases, tables, fields, relations, indexes, users, permissions, etc, while you still have the ability to directly execute any sql statement.
First we will create a password file with users using the htpasswd tool that comes with the apache package. How to access phpmyadmin via ssh tunnel gcp one page zen. How to install mysql with phpmyadmin on debian 7 linode. The phpmyadmin developer team is putting lot of effort to make phpmyadmin as secure as possible. When you apply the given fixes they make phpmyadmin stop working which is much worse than a warning.
Phpmyadmin will be installed in usrsharephpmyadmin. With phpmyadmin, you can create and manage databases and users, execute sqlstatements, import and export data, and performing database activities such as, creating, deleting, tables, columns, indexes, permissions and many more. Frequently used operations managing databases, tables, columns, relations, indexes, users, permissions, etc can be performed via the user interface, while you. After successful login, head to the application folder where you want to download phpmyadmin by using the following command. If your domain is not already protected by an ssl you can follow this guide and secure your apache with lets encrypt on debian 9. This brief tutorial shows students and new users how to download the latest version of phpmyadmin package and manually install and configure it on ubuntu 16.
This article was coauthored by our trained team of editors and researchers who validated it for accuracy and comprehensiveness. Browse and drop databases, tables, views, fields and indexes. Secure phpmyadmin phpmyadmin is now installed and configured. When youre ready to manually install phpmyadmin, follow the steps below. Securing your phpmyadmin installation the phpmyadmin team tries hard to make the application secure, however there are always ways to make your installation more secure. How to install phpmyadmin on managed hosting accounts. As we mentioned in the previous tip, do not attempt to do this yet if you dont want to expose your credentials. Efficient, not to add any extra loadslowness to site. In addition to the lamp stack we will also install phpmyadmin for the database access and vsftpd server for the ftp access. Adminer datenbankverwaltung in einer einzigen phpdatei. However, if you want to use a version of phpmyadmin.
Frequently used operations managing databases, tables, columns, relations, indexes, users, permissions, etc can be performed via the user. In this tip, we will show you how to change and secure the default phpmyadmin login url to stop attackers from targeting your linux server. If youre running a server which cannot be accessed by other people, its sufficient to use the directory protection bundled with your webserver with apache you can use. It works same for ubuntu, debian distros, linux mint, kubuntu and all debian like operating systems. Use wget to download the latest phpmyadmin version. Also, replace password with a secure password of your choice. How to install and secure phpmyadmin with apache on debian. I am going to configure phpmyadmin on port 9000 in this article. Version, upload comment, works with typo3, download.
How to install phpmyadmin on iis in windows server secure. My browser is internet explorer and im using the apache server. So, you will need to download the latest version of the phpmyadmin from. Install and secure phpmyadmin on centos 8 howtoforge. Apr 21, 2020 in this guide, well discuss how to install and secure phpmyadmin so that you can safely use it to manage your databases on an ubuntu 18. In 2019, phpmyadmin has been the target of random attacks from botnets. Adminer is available for mysql, mariadb, postgresql, sqlite, ms sql, oracle. Before you get started with this guide, you need to have some basic steps completed. Jun 01, 2018 how to install and configure phpmyadmin on debian 8. How to change and secure default phpmyadmin login url.
How to install and secure phpmyadmin with apache on debian 9. This tutorial covers the process of installing and securing phpmyadmin on an ubuntu 18. Nevertheless the link i provided gives more insight to the process of configuring phpmyadmin catalesia mar 15 at 14. In this article, i am going to show you how to install phpmyadmin on debian 10 buster. How to install phpmyadmin on the raspberry pi pi my life up. During phpmyadmin installation process, a prompt will open which will ask you about the web server you are using.
It is hugely popular and used in a lot of web server. Before getting started with this tutorial, you should have already installed putty, which is the ssh client that you will be using in this tutorial. Xampp configuration to secure mysql, phpmyadmin and localhost posted on april 26, 20 by rferdian45 this is a note how to configure xampp after installing xampp in. The owner and group of the opt phpmyadmin directory and contents of the directory should be changed to data. Revised for security to be reliable and free of vulnerability holes. Ensure that the config directory exists and has the proper permissions or use the download link to save the config file locally and upload via ftp or some similar means. Direct linkurl to access phpmyadmin without installing software.
However additional steps can be taken to make it further secure. Visit the phpmyadmin download page to grab the latest version of phpmyadmin. The solution to the problem can be found at the link. If you have ubuntu system check what to do after installing ubuntu 14. Aug, 2017 introduction phpmyadmin is a free and opensource software written in php programming language to provide you the ability to take control of your mysql database over the internet. In this guide, well discuss how to install and secure phpmyadmin so that you can safely use it to manage your databases from an ubuntu 16. Wampdeveloper pro with phpmyadmin easytouse web server software using apache, php, mysql and phpmyadmin. To add an extra layer of security we will password protect the phpmyadmin directory by setting up a basic authentication. We can easily secure our phpmyadmin installation by using apaches builtin.
After that it will ask about the root user password. Connect to phpmyadmin for security reasons, phpmyadmin is accessible only when using 127. Follow the steps below t o install phpmyadmin on your domain. The mysql database system is the most popular, opensource, relational database. Prerequisites before you get started with this guide, you need to have some basic steps completed. Xampp configuration to secure mysql, phpmyadmin and. Want to manually install the latest versions of phpmyadmin on ubuntu.
Archive of phpmyadmin releases, you can find currently supported versions on downloads page. Xampp configuration to secure mysql, phpmyadmin and localhost. How to install and configure phpmyadmin on debian 8. But, it is recommended to secure your phpmyadmin instance to prevent unauthorized access you can secure phpmyadmin by using apaches builtin. Now go to phpmyadmin website and copy the download url of the latest version of phpmyadmin zipped format. Running all parts of this script is recommended for all mariadb servers in production use. On the nginx web server, we just need to create a symbolic link of phpmyadmin installation files to our nginx document root.
This is a much better and more robust method of restricting access over hardcoding urls and ip addresses into apaches nf. How to access phpmyadmin directly without cpanel login. Introduction phpmyadmin is a free and opensource software written in php programming language to provide you the ability to take control of your mysql database over the internet. In this tutorial you will learn how to setup a web server on freebsd using apache, php and mysqlmariadb database server. For that reason, you should keep phpmyadmin updated, as it will have the latest patches against recent exploits, and secure it against automated attacks by adding extra layers of security. Ok, so i have several sites on a vps with ssl certificates. Were talking about a very stable and totally secure system to completely manage the mysql database of your website or any other web application. Download the latest stable version of the phpmyadmin software here. How to install and configure phpmyadmin on debian 8 linode. To begin the installation of phpmyadmin, access the installation url at. The basic and advanced packages include additional features and a download link to the source code.
79 245 49 1085 629 45 727 36 1409 1560 1055 390 242 123 111 148 971 789 1554 1560 1560 339 1330 707 308 1269 1236 1619 272 1423 1370 763 225 160 249 220 874 525